Strong's H2642 (Hebrew)
Hebrew: חֶסְרוֹן (cheçrôwn)
Pronunciation: khes-rone'
Morphology: n-m
Derivation: from חָסֵר (châçêr) H2637
Definition: deficiency
KJV Renderings: wanting
Senses
- the thing lacking, defect, deficiency
